About the Liberty Theatre:

The Liberty Theatre, affectionately known as the "Heart of Astoria," is a nonprofit, historic performing arts venue dedicated to enriching the cultural landscape of our community. We are primarily a "roadhouse" presenter, meaning we host touring artists and productions rather than producing in-house shows. Our programming focuses heavily on live music, with additional performances in comedy, dance, theatre, and community events. We are currently planning a major stage renovation that will enhance our technical capabilities, ensuring the Liberty Theatre remains a premier destination for performers and audiences alike.

Mission: The historic Liberty Theatre is a regional gathering place fostering a vibrant, diverse community through performing arts, cultural experiences, and educational programs.

Position Summary:

The Technical Director is responsible for overseeing all technical aspects of theatre operations and productions at the Liberty Theatre. This role ensures the successful execution of events by managing lighting, sound, set design, and stage management. The Technical Director collaborates with performers, renters, staff, and volunteers to deliver high-quality productions that meet the artistic and technical standards of the theatre.

Key Responsibilities: Technical Operations Management:

  • Oversee the daily technical operations of the theatre, including lighting, sound, set design, and stage management.
  • Design and implement lighting plots, sound systems, and staging configurations tailored to each event’s specific requirements.
  • Ensure all technical equipment is properly maintained, repaired, and updated as necessary.

Production Planning and Coordination:

  • Collaborate with performers, production teams, and renters to assess and fulfill technical requirements for upcoming events.
  • Develop and manage production schedules, including load-in, setup, rehearsals, performances, strike, and load-out.
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for technical inquiries and coordination during events.

Team Leadership and Supervision:

  • Recruit, train, and supervise technical staff, including volunteers and contracted personnel.
  • Retain and oversee outside contractors when additional equipment or labor is required for events.
  • Foster a collaborative and safe working environment, ensuring adherence to safety protocols and industry standards.

Budgeting and Resource Management:

  • Prepare and manage budgets for technical aspects of productions, ensuring cost-effective use of resources.
  • Maintain inventory of technical equipment and order specialized supplies.
  • Advise management on future improvements, development needs, and capital purchases of equipment and materials.

Physical Requirements:

  • Ability to lift and carry up to 50 lbs.
  • Comfortable working at heights and using ladders.
  • Ability to move and work in confined spaces, such as catwalks and backstage areas.
  • Ability to stand, walk, and perform physical tasks for extended periods.

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Technical Theatre, Theatre Production, or a related field, or equivalent professional experience.
  • Proven experience as a Technical Director or in a similar role within a performing arts venue.
  • Comprehensive knowledge of technical theatre operations, including lighting, sound, rigging, and set construction.
  • Strong leadership and team management skills, with experience supervising staff and volunteers.
  • Excellent organizational and problem-solving abilities.
  • Effective commun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Ability to work flexible hours, including evenings and weekends, to accommodate the theatre’s schedule.
